Mason Brown to Perform at Prospero’s Bookstore

Crack open a regionally brewed beer on Sunday while area folk musician Mason Brown performs at Prospero’s Bookstore (1800 West 39th Street, 816-531-9673). Brown’s instrumental repertoire includes banjo, guitar and viola da gamba, which is a stringed instrument that’s like a violin but bigger – it’s rested on the knee as it’s played. Brown will sing on Sunday, too, during a CD release party for his new album When Humans Walked the Earth. The free concert starts at 6 p.m. Weston Brewing Company will provide the complimentary beers.
